Senior Revenue Data Analyst - UK
At Paymentology , we’re redefining what’s possible in the payments space. As the first truly global issuer-processor, we give banks and fintechs the technology and talent to launch and manage Mastercard, Visa cards at scale - across more than 60 countries.
Our advanced, multi-cloud platform delivers real-time data, unmatched scalability, and the flexibility of shared or dedicated processing instances. It's this global reach and innovation that sets us apart.
We’re looking for a Senior Revenue Data Analyst to act as a domain expert in commercial analytics—owning forecasting, pricing, and sales performance insights. You’ll architect scalable models and reporting infrastructure, and serve as a strategic advisor to Revenue, Finance, and Product to power confident, data-driven decisions.
What you get to do::- Architect forecasting models and reporting decks for revenue tracking, pipeline health, and pricing insights
- Partner with FP&A stakeholders to define metrics, establish data governance, and align reporting across teams
- Conduct deep-dive analysis on pricing effectiveness, retention trends, deal ROI, and win/loss outcomes to inform strategy
- Build and maintain dashboards and tooling that enable self-service access to commercial performance data across functions
- Proactively identify leading indicators, surfacing risks and opportunities across regions and market segments

REQUIREMENTS
What it takes to succeed:
- Strong command of Excel with experience building scenario and forecasting models
- Familiarity with CRM systems and the ability to define clear metrics and reporting inputs
- Exceptional communication skills to translate data findings for non-technical stakeholders
- Proven ability to align cross-functional teams around commercial insights and shared data definitions
- Comfort solving unstructured problems, designing scalable analytics frameworks, and evaluating trade-offs in metrics, tooling, and assumptions
Education and Experience:
- 5 or more years of data analytics experience, including at least 3 years in revenue analytics, commercial operations, or FP&A
- Bachelor’s degree in a quantitative, business, or related field preferred
- Experience operating with high autonomy and influencing stakeholders across Revenue, Finance, Product, and Tech
